Where is This Primary Shutoff Situated?


The primary water line supply can differ, so you might need to find time to figure out where it is. Unfortunately, when your residence is getting drenched due to a ruptured pipe, you don't have the luxury of time throughout an emergency. Therefore, you should get ready for this plumbing situation by learning where the valve is located.
This shutoff valve might appear like a sphere shutoff (with a lever-type take care of) or a gateway valve (with a circle faucet). Placement relies on the age of your residence and also the climate in your location. Check the complying with usual spots:
  • Interior of House: In cooler environments, the city supply pipes encounter your home. Inspect usual energy locations like your cellar, utility room, or garage. A most likely area is near the water heater. In the basement, this shutoff will certainly go to your eye degree. On the various other main floors, you may need to bend down to find it.

  • Outdoors on the Outside Wall surface: The major shutoff is outside the home in exotic climates where they don't experience winter season. It is typically linked to an exterior wall surface. Look for it near an outside faucet.

  • Outdoors by the Street: If you can not discover the shutoff anywhere else, it is time to examine your street. Maybe outdoors next to your water meter. It could be below the access panel near the ground on your street. You might need a meter secret that's marketed in hardware stores to take off the panel cover. You can discover 2 valves, one for city use as well as one for your house. Make sure you turned off the right one. And also you will understand that you did when none of the taps in your home launch freshwater.

    What to Do When a Pipe Bursts in Your Home


    A burst pipe is one of a homeowner's worst nightmares. Not knowing the signs and being unprepared for this plumbing issue can result in more water damage and clean up. Here are the warning signs of a pipe about to burst and the steps you can take if it happens.


    Warning Signs for Burst Pipes


  • Rusty, discolored water with a bad smell


  • Puddles under your sinks


  • Abrupt changes in water pressure


  • A spike in your water bill


  • Clanging noises coming from pipes behind the walls


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ts


    Turn off your water. The sooner you do this, the better. Shutting off your main valve will help minimize the damage to your home.



    Drain the faucets. After the water has been turned off, drain the remaining water by opening your faucets. Doing so will help prevent areas from freezing and also relieve pressure within your pipe system to avoid more bursts.



    Locate the burst pipe. Look for bulging ceilings, warping and other signs of where the water damage has occurred. Once you locate the pipe, you will be able to determine if it is a small crack that can be patched or a major repair that needs to be dealt with right away.

    Document the damage. If you have extensive pipe damage, be sure to take photos of the affected areas so you can document a claim with your insurance. Take close-up photos of the damage and use a measuring tape to show how high the water is. You should also take photos from different angles for a wider picture of the affected areas.



    Start cleaning. After you have documented the damage, start cleaning up the water as soon as possible. The longer the water sits, the higher the chance that mold will develop.
